加纳腰果产业潜力达6.6亿美元

Core Insights - The cashew industry in Ghana has the potential to generate over $660 million annually if effectively regulated, supported by adequate processing infrastructure and strong export facilitation [1] - Cashew is one of Ghana's most valuable export commodities, playing a crucial role in non-traditional export revenue and rural employment [1] - Currently, Ghana exports cashews worth approximately $300 million annually, with over 90% exported as raw nuts rather than processed nuts, missing significant opportunities for value addition and economic growth [1] Industry Measures - The Ghana Tree Crop Development Authority is implementing measures to stabilize agricultural product purchase prices, strengthen licensing processes, and ensure transparency across the value chain [1] - These initiatives aim to protect farmers from market exploitation, attract investment for local processing facilities, and solidify Ghana's position as a leading cashew exporter in West Africa [1]
俄罗斯对智利海产品开放市场

Core Viewpoint - The Russian Federal Service for Veterinary and Phytosanitary Surveillance has agreed to continue allowing Chilean seafood exports to Russia after lifting some trade barriers, while also addressing compliance issues with certain Chilean companies [1] Group 1: Trade Relations - Russia confirmed the opening of its market to Chilean seafood, allowing 34 Chilean companies to continue exporting fishery and aquaculture products [1] - A cooperation agreement was signed to facilitate exports and ensure legal certification of origin, enhancing collaboration against illegal fishing [1] Group 2: Compliance Issues - Seven Chilean companies were found to have compliance violations during audits, leading to the suspension of their sanitary export certifications with a deadline for rectification [1] - Since 2020, Russia has imposed restrictions on Chilean processed products due to antibiotic detection in farmed salmon [1] Group 3: Export Data - In the first nine months of 2024, Chile's seafood exports to Russia reached 46,000 tons, valued at $28.5 million [1]
